Key differences between regional versions

The first thing a customer faces is a few modifications, the main difference being the processor and network support. The global version, known as the Redmi Note 5 Pro in India and simply the Redmi Note 5 in Europe, is based on the Qualcomm chipset. At the same time, the Chinese counterpart, often called the Redmi Note 5 AI, may have different characteristics.

It is important to understand that Chinese versions often lack critical LTE bands. If you buy a device designed exclusively for the domestic market of China, you risk being left without 4G Internet when traveling outside the city or even in some areas of megacities.

CPU battle: Snapdragon 636 vs. competitors

The heart of the successful global version was the Qualcomm Snapdragon 636, a chipset that was a breakthrough in the budget segment, offering performance close to the flagships of the previous generation, and it is the presence of this processor that makes the smartphone relevant even a few years after its release.

Some versions, especially the early Chinese ones, have the Snapdragon 625 or 630, which are good but less powerful chips. The difference in interface speed and heavy applications between the 636 and 625 is palpable to the naked eye, so when you choose which is better, the answer is clear: look for the version on the 636th dragon.

The 14nm process provides a great balance between power consumption and heating. The smartphone rarely suffers from trotting (reduced frequency due to overheating), which is typical of cheaper counterparts. the Adreno 509 graphics accelerator allows you to run popular games on medium settings with a comfortable FPS.

To test the real CPU, use the CPU-Z or AIDA64 app. Marketplace vendors sometimes indicate incorrect characteristics in the product card, trying to pass the old model as a new one.

However, it is worth remembering that even a powerful processor will not save if RAM is scarce.The minimum comfortable option today is the configuration of 4/64 GB. Versions with 3 GB of RAM will experience difficulties with multitasking in modern conditions.

Cameras: Dual module and processing algorithms

One of the main arguments in favor of this model was the camera, which has the main Sony IMX362 sensor with an aperture of f/1.9 in the global version, the same sensor that was used in the flagship Google Pixel 2, which indicates its high potential.

The second camera acts as a telephoto lens with two-fold optical zoom, allowing you to take high-quality portraits with natural background blur. AI algorithms built into MIUI Camera are great at recognizing scenes. At night, the smartphone also performs above average for its class thanks to optical stabilization (OIS).

The front camera has its own flash and infrared sensor to unlock the face in the dark, which is rare in the budget segment. Video quality is limited to FullHD at 30 frames per second, which is standard, but not more.

โš ๏ธ Note: In Chinese versions with Snapdragon processor 625 Often, completely different, weaker cameras are installed (for example, the camera is installed, 12+5 Visually, the camera block may look similar, but the quality of the photo will be significantly worse.

Software-based processing of photos depends on the firmware version. Global versions often have a more โ€œnaturalโ€ color reproduction, while Chinese versions can over-saturate colors. For enthusiasts, the Google Camera (GCam) installation is available, which unlocks the potential of Sonyโ€™s sensor to the maximum.

Screen and multimedia capabilities

The display of the smartphone is made by IPS technology with a diagonal of 5.99 inches and a resolution of FullHD +. The pixel density is 403 ppi, which provides excellent picture clarity. Color reproduction is set up quite brightly, although the brightness reserves on a sunny day can be at the limit.

The 18:9 aspect ratio allows you to comfortably hold the device with one hand, despite the large screen.Gorilla Glass protective glass (according to the manufacturer) is present, but its thickness and real resistance raise questions among users.

Technical details of the screen matrix
Matrice manufacturer Sharp or Tianma (depending on the batch). Upgrade frequency is standard - 60 Hz. Multi-touch support - 10 points. Brightness varies from 450 to 500 nits depending on the calibration.

The soundtrack is equipped with a separate DAC, which provides clean sound in the headphones. The speaker one, located on the lower end, it is quite loud, but lacks deep bass. For multimedia, having a separate 3.5 mm jack is a huge plus, allowing you to use high-quality wired acoustics without delay.

Autonomy and charging speed

A 4,000mAh battery coupled with the energy-efficient Snapdragon 636 processor delivers great autonomy. In mixed-use mode (social media, calls, a little video), the device lives easily for a day and a half to two, one of those rare cases where the declared capacity matches reality.

Support for Quick Charge 3.0 fast charging technology allows you to recharge the battery from 0 to 50% in about 30-40 minutes. However, the package often comes with a conventional 10W charger (in older shipments) or 18W (in new ones).

  • ๐Ÿ”‹ Talk time โ€“ up to 20 hours.
  • ๐Ÿ”‹ Video playback - before 12-14 watch-watch.
  • ๐Ÿ”‹ Standby mode โ€“ minimum charge consumption due to optimization MIUI.

The battery inevitably degrades over time, and when you buy a used device, the battery's condition is a key issue, and if the capacity has dropped below 80 percent, you have to budget for the replacement cost.

Communication, NFC and Navigation

This is one of the most painful issues for this model: the global version of the Redmi Note 5 (model code M1803E6GG) does not have an NFC module. This is a confirmed fact that often comes as a surprise to customers expecting contactless payment. In some regions (for example, India) there were versions with NFC, but there are very few of them.

And in terms of navigation, it depends on the version. GPS, GLONASS and Galileo โ€“ Chinese versions may have trouble mapping themselves in some navigators, although the coordinates are correct. SIM-cards implemented through a hybrid slot: either two SIMs or SIM + memory-card.

โš ๏ธ Please do not believe the sellers who say that NFC You can program it on a global version, the antennas and the chip are not physically on the board, and the only way is by making complex hardware modifications that nobody does en masse.
